откуда color было удалено?
Этот топик читают: Гость
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
карма: 27 |
|
Ответов: 16884
Рейтинг: 1239
|
|||
Раньше в редакторе форм видны были цвета, а сейчас - только после компиляции.
Черно-белое кино получилось. ------------ Дoбавленo: и все визуальные компоненты имеют размер 400х300. |
|||
карма: 25 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ma, глянь на SVN, я подкорректировал некоторые *.ini. В основном те, в которые я вернул не Win-color.
------------ Дoбавленo: Tad писал(а): и все визуальные компоненты имеют размер 400х300------------ Дoбавленo: Графические компоненты, такие как GProgressBar, тоже трогать нельзя, нарушается привязка к передаче параметров в *.dll при Custom-методе отображения на форме. ------------ Дoбавленo: Dilma, мне кажется, глобальную секцию [Property] нужно вернуть на место каждому. |
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
nesco писал(а): я подкорректировал некоторые *.ini.зря совет на будущее: не стоит забегать вперед паровоза |
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ma, премного извини Тут не понятна стала логика с Coloro'м. Я относительно понял твой замысел со свойствами, общими для всех Win-компонентов, но вот со свойствами цветов некоторых компонентов, совершенно разных, мне стало не понятно. В самом WinControle, я ничего не менял, только точки местами переставил. В TabControl затесалось свойство ParentFont, которое вынесено в WinControl, вот его я вытер, да и в StringTable вернул onColumnClick больше ничего не трогал.
|
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
Color не через ini задается
|
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ma писал(а): Color не через ini задается |
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
дефолтный профиль
|
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ma писал(а): дефолтный профиль------------ Дoбавленo: Dilma, разъясни подробнее fixes писал(а): 1:24 19.12.2007
- add: возврат parent sdk для элемента в cgt - add: множественное наследование в конфигах - fix: безусловное применение профиля Особенно, последний пункт. ------------ Дoбавленo: И еще, никак не могу догнать возможность профилирования дефолтных свойств, которые отсутствуют в списке свойств (набор настраиваемой цветовой гаммы элементов компонента, например для LedNumber'a, которые исчезли из *.ini файла. И как их запрофилировать, если их вообще нигде нет, вручную, что ли?). И как вообще обычный стандартный пользователь будет получать дефолтные профили? Dilma, серьезно наблюдается явный недостаток информации |
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
Раньше профиль по-умолчанию применялся только при вставке элемента из палитры в среду. Теперь применяется сразу после инициализации любого нового элемента.
|
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ma, у меня получилось создать дефолтный профиль только тогда, когда я настроил компонент и нажал галочку профиля, создался профиль типа MainForm%cur.prf. После этих манипуляций, при кидании компонента на форму, к нему этот профиль и применяется.
|
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
все работает и применяется
|
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ma писал(а): все работает и применяетсяDilma писал(а): Теперь применяется сразу после инициализации любого нового элементаВот переписал я все файлы *.ini. У той же кнопки, размер по-умолчанию стал 400x300, как у нее размер станет по-умолчанию 55x20, если я его ручками не изменю и не пересохраню профиль? |
|||
карма: 22 |
|
Администрация
Ответов: 15295
Рейтинг: 1519
|
|||
под этим понимается вызов AplyProfile из create в классе TElement. В идеале этот профиль должен менять параметры по умолчанию еще в шаблоне, по которому строится элемент. Однако не вижу какой толк для конечного пользователя от этого знания.
|
|||
карма: 27 |
|
Разработчик
Ответов: 26151
Рейтинг: 2127
|
|||
Dilma, ну хорошо, это все в идеале, а на данный момент, что делать, настраивать профили самому? Ну никак я не пойму, что сейчас отвечает за размеры на форме, кроме WinControl'a или созданного дефолтного профиля?
|
|||
карма: 22 |
|